Greg Bryant’s 1973 38ft Drifter
The boat is a 1973 Drifter 38’ with twin 120 mercruisers
and a 6.5 onan. The story of this boat and us began in 1994 when my dad
purchased it from a local guy who had owned it for several years. We owned it
for a year or so when dad decided to sell our house so the boat had to go. We
sold it to a guy who lived on it until last year when he forgot to charge the
battery and the bilge didn’t work and the back half went under which ruined the
engines and generator. Well that was one project that we wished we would have
finished so we tracked it down and bought it back in much worse shape that it
was when we sold it. We rebuilt both walls and redecked the roof and are
waiting for the weather to break so we can install the elastometric roofing and
siding.
We have located two 120 mercruisers and a generator to replace the
damaged ones. We talked to Clyde Head from Harbor Master boats and he said that
he actually built the boat for himself when they used to be Drifter. He was for
sure that this was the boat because it was the only 38’ that had twin 120’s so
I thought that was pretty neat. The hull is pretty solid with only a couple of
bad spots. The hull will receive a sandblasting an fresh coat of tar epoxy when
the weather allows us to. As soon as we get the siding on we will refurbish the
interior.
